Talent.com
Senior Software Engineer – AI Automation & Runtime Systems
Senior Software Engineer – AI Automation & Runtime SystemsYularatech • Delhi, India
Senior Software Engineer – AI Automation & Runtime Systems

Senior Software Engineer – AI Automation & Runtime Systems

Yularatech • Delhi, India
10 hours ago
Job description

Position Title :

Senior Software Engineer – AI Automation & Runtime Systems

Department :

IT – Software Development

Experience Level :

Minimum of 5+ years of hands-on professional experience in building AI-driven automation systems, scalable backend components, and cross-platform UI interaction frameworks.

Manager :

Head of India Operations

Direct Reports : NA

Hire type : Contract

Location : Remote

Work-times : IST timezone

Tag :

Python Engineer – AI Agent & Cross-Platform Automation, Senior Software Engineer – AI & Automation, Lead Software Engineer – Automation Systems

Yularatech is an IT services provider offering end-to-end quality IT solutions to our partner clients. We specialize in IT skills resourcing, IT consulting and outsourced application development and support.

Position Summary

We are seeking a Senior Software Engineer to help build an AI assistant that can operate software interfaces like a human across web, desktop, and remote applications.

The role involves strong

Python development, UI interaction automation,

and designing reliable, secure, cross-platform execution flows. You will work on core runtime systems, concurrency models, accessibility integrations, and adaptive UI handling to ensure the AI performs tasks safely, consistently, and intelligently.

Key Responsibilities

AI Agent & Computer Interaction Automation Responsibilities

Build core components enabling the AI agent to operate software interfaces like a human.

Implement systems that allow the AI to click, type, fill forms, navigate apps, and handle pop-ups.

Design robust UI-state detection logic to ensure the AI works even when layouts change.

Build fallback and recovery flows for non-deterministic or unexpected UI behavior.

Enable the AI to operate across web apps, desktop apps, and remote desktops.

Ensure all AI actions comply with security, authentication, and company policies.

Core Engineering Responsibilities

Build new product features and modules from scratch.

Work with UI interaction layers for web and desktop environments.

Develop and maintain backend services and core application components.

Implement Desktop UI automation and integrate with OS accessibility APIs.

Enable stable cross-platform execution across Windows and Mac.

Handle async execution, concurrency, and multi-process workflows.

Design runtime sandboxing and enforce strong security boundaries.

Manage non-deterministic UI behaviour and build reliable fallback logic.

Implement logging, tracing, error handling, and debugging systems.

Collaborate closely with frontend, DevOps, QA, and product teams.

Support cloud deployments (preferably AWS) and CI / CD pipelines.

Mandatory Skills

AI Interaction & Automation Skills

Experience building automation systems that interact with UI elements (buttons, forms, pop-ups, modals).

Ability to design reliable, human-like UI interaction flows for web, desktop, and remote environments.

Strong understanding of screen-level automation, UI element detection, and fallback logic.

Familiarity with tools or frameworks that simulate human interaction (accessibility APIs, UI automation APIs).

Ability to design safe automation that respects permissions and security boundaries.

Core Technical Skills

Strong programming experience in Python (must-have).

Good understanding of APIs, microservices, and backend system design.

Experience with Desktop UI automation and OS accessibility APIs.

Basic experience with async programming and event-driven architectures.

Experience with SQL / NoSQL databases (PostgreSQL, MySQL, DynamoDB, MongoDB).

Experience with cloud platforms (preferably AWS – Lambda, ECS, API Gateway, SQS, RDS).

Strong understanding of concurrency, async flows, and multi-process execution.

Experience using Git and Agile development processes.

Ability to work independently without needing architect-level responsibilities.

Good to Have

Experience working with

Windows and Mac desktop environments .

Knowledge of runtime sandboxing, isolation, and system security boundaries.

Experience with

UI automation , web runtimes (DOM), Chromium or browser engine internals.

Exposure to

OS accessibility APIs

(Windows UIA, macOS Accessibility, etc.).

Working familiarity with non-deterministic UI behaviour.

Knowledge of Terraform / CloudFormation (IaC).

ML / CV experience is desirable.

Experience with LLM-driven decision models.

Experience in fintech, payments, or transaction-heavy systems.

Knowledge of monitoring tools like CloudWatch or Datadog.

Create a job alert for this search

Software Engineer Ai • Delhi, India

Related jobs
AI Software Engineer

AI Software Engineer

Quik Hire • Ghaziabad, IN
This role is ideal for professionals passionate about artificial intelligence, machine learning, and software engineering who want to make a tangible impact on real-world applications.As an AI Soft...Show more
Last updated: 6 days ago • Promoted
AI Automation Engineer

AI Automation Engineer

Vagaro • delhi, delhi, in
Develop and deploy AI-driven automation workflows and chatbots integrated into existing applications to improve efficiency and user experience. Design and implement AI-based automation using Python,...Show more
Last updated: 18 days ago • Promoted
Senior AI Engineer

Senior AI Engineer

NextDimension AI • Delhi, India
INR 12-30 LPA Base + Bonus + Equity Location : .US-based technology startup building AI Agents in Healthcare, established by a team of distinguished AI / ML Scientists and Engineers from.We're empoweri...Show more
Last updated: 12 days ago • Promoted
Ai Software Engineer

Ai Software Engineer

Taskify AI • Noida, Republic Of India, IN
This role is ideal for professionals passionate about artificial intelligence, machine learning, and software engineering who want to make a tangible impact on real-world applications.As an AI Soft...Show more
Last updated: 6 days ago • Promoted
Senior Software Engineer (AI / ML)

Senior Software Engineer (AI / ML)

Confidential • Noida, India
Siemens EDA : Shaping the Future.Siemens EDA is a global technology leader at the forefront of Electronic Design Automation (EDA) software. Our innovative tools empower companies worldwide to develop...Show more
Last updated: 3 days ago • Promoted
Agentic AI & n8n Automation Expert

Agentic AI & n8n Automation Expert

Dentalkart • Delhi, India, India
Agentic AI & n8n Automation Expert.The ideal candidate must have strong experience in automation tools, API integrations, and building multi-step automated processes. Build advanced n8n workflows, i...Show more
Last updated: 7 days ago • Promoted
Senior Lead Software Engineer AI [T500-18290]

Senior Lead Software Engineer AI [T500-18290]

ANSR • Delhi, India
About 4flow : Headquartered in Berlin, Germany, 4flow provides consulting, software and services for logistics and supply chain management. More than 1300 team members leverage their supply chain exp...Show more
Last updated: 15 days ago • Promoted
Senior Software Engineer (AI / LLM / RAG)

Senior Software Engineer (AI / LLM / RAG)

Whatfix • Delhi, India
Whatfix is an AI platform advancing the “userization” of enterprise applications, empowering companies to maximize the ROI of their digital investments. As AI reshapes roles, workflows, and human-ma...Show more
Last updated: 30+ days ago • Promoted
Senior AI Systems Engineer

Senior AI Systems Engineer

ISIR AI • Noida, Republic Of India, IN
Senior Full Stack Engineer (Lead) – AI Platform & Agentic Systems.Noida (Onsite) | 🕒 Full-Time | 🚀 Immediate Start.AI is building next-generation. Senior Full Stack Engineer (Lead).UI engineering ...Show more
Last updated: 13 days ago • Promoted
Senior Ai & Automation Engineer

Senior Ai & Automation Engineer

engineersmind • Ghāziābād, Republic Of India, IN
Role : Senior AI & Automation Engineer.Quality Engineering & Product Assurance.API layers, ensuring seamless integration, performance, and security. This is a hands-on role that requires strong techn...Show more
Last updated: 8 days ago • Promoted
Senior Ai Application Engineer

Senior Ai Application Engineer

Foodsmart • Noida, Republic Of India, IN
Foodsmart is the leading telenutrition and foodcare solution, backed by a robust network of Registered Dietitians.Our platform is designed to foster healthier food choices, drive lasting behavior c...Show more
Last updated: 11 days ago • Promoted
Senior AI & Automation Engineer

Senior AI & Automation Engineer

engineersmind • Delhi, India
Role : Senior AI & Automation Engineer.Quality Engineering & Product Assurance.API layers, ensuring seamless integration, performance, and security. This is a hands-on role that requires strong techn...Show more
Last updated: 7 days ago • Promoted
Senior Software Engineer (AI Applications)

Senior Software Engineer (AI Applications)

AlphaSense • Delhi, Delhi, India
The worlds most sophisticated companies rely on AlphaSense to remove uncertainty from decision-making.With market intelligence and search built on proven AI AlphaSense delivers insights that matter...Show more
Last updated: 21 days ago • Promoted
Senior AI Application Engineer

Senior AI Application Engineer

Foodsmart • Ghaziabad, Uttar Pradesh, India
About us : Foodsmart is the leading telenutrition and foodcare solution, backed by a robust network of Registered Dietitians. Our platform is designed to foster healthier food choices, drive lasting ...Show more
Last updated: 11 days ago • Promoted
Senior Ai Engineer

Senior Ai Engineer

SmarTek21 • Ghāziābād, Republic Of India, IN
We are looking for a highly skilled AI Engineer to build and scale enterprise-grade AI solutions using advanced LLMs, agent frameworks, and automation platforms. In this hands-on role, you will desi...Show more
Last updated: 21 days ago • Promoted
Ai Software Engineer

Ai Software Engineer

Quik Hire • Ghāziābād, Republic Of India, IN
This role is ideal for professionals passionate about artificial intelligence, machine learning, and software engineering who want to make a tangible impact on real-world applications.As an AI Soft...Show more
Last updated: 6 days ago • Promoted
Senior Software Engineer - AI

Senior Software Engineer - AI

Deep Cognition • Delhi, India
Large Language Model (LLM) APIs.OpenAI, Anthropic, or similar frameworks.The ideal candidate will have a strong background in. Python , API integration, and workflow automation, with a passion for b...Show more
Last updated: 5 days ago • Promoted
AI Software Engineer

AI Software Engineer

Taskify AI • Ghaziabad, IN
This role is ideal for professionals passionate about artificial intelligence, machine learning, and software engineering who want to make a tangible impact on real-world applications.As an AI Soft...Show more
Last updated: 6 days ago • Promoted